Data Architect

The Opportunity:

For an organization to transform in today's digital world, it needs to properly collect, store, and organize its data. Effective data management can enable more efficient operations, yielding more growth. As a data architect, you know how to apply your creative-thinking and analytical mindset to help organizations manage their data assets. We're looking for an experienced data architect like you to deliver leading-edge solutions for the Navy.

As a data architect on our team, you'll use your extensive technical expertise to design data architecture solutions for the strategy of creating a data lake providing comprehensive analytic capabilities through a transformation initiative. You'll resolve routine data architecture issues in collaboration with business analysts and technology teams by working with project teams to understand the challenge and make recommendations on the future data architecture to overcome.

In this role, you'll grow your technical expertise, apply best practices, and use tools like Databricks, AWS data services, and Tableau. You'll guide your team as it designs, defines, develops, and tests cloud solution components, and you'll serve as a liaison between clients and developers to ensure that requirements are met, and solutions are delivered.

With your drive to establish processes and lead technological innovation, you'll make a lasting impact on the Navy.This position is a hybrid role with a combination of working at a Booz Allen office or client site and working remotely.

You Have:

  • 6+ years of experience with data architecture and databases in an IT consulting or engineering role
  • Experience with DoD data architecture or software systems
  • Experience in working with data leveraging cloud capabilities, including AWS, Azure, or GCP
  • Secret clearance
  • Bachelor's degree

Nice If You Have:

  • Experience with applying big data concepts in a data lake
  • Knowledge of data strategy, big data tools, and both structured and unstructured data
  • Knowledge of enterprise transformation initiatives
  • Possession of excellent verbal and written communication skills
  • Possession of excellent client-facing or consulting skills
  • Master's degree in an IT-related field
  • Data Architecture Certification
